There was a knock on the door, and Jane answered it. It was Mr. Dudley, the farmer who delivered eggs each week. Under one arm he clutched a little brown Irish terrier.

"Would you like to keep her?" he asked.

Jane took the pup in her arms. She had longed for a dog of her own and had trusted God with her desire. Now it was just as if He was sending one to her.
